General Guidelines for project work and evaluation
The topic will be assigned by the guiding teachers. Scope, details, analysis and
deviations, if any will be as per the advice of your guiding teacher.
The projects will be for about 35 pages, A 4 size, Single side, single line spacing, Times
new Roman, size 12, headings in 14 size
The Report of project work shall be submitted as a hard bound document with following
details
1. Cover Page, hard bound, black calico, with embossed printing :
2. Inner cover is copy of cover page

4. Acknowledgements
5. Contents
6. The Report: In black and white . Color to be used only incase of analytical graphs.
Picture should avoided as far as possible
7. References : quote in standard format
For books
Author (Year) “title of book’, Publisher, Place
For articles
Author (Year) “title of article’, Name of Journal, Publisher, Voulme, date of
publication, Place
Web references
Author “title of article’, the site publisher, URL, IP address (if possible), Date

Evaluation
The Project will be evaluated for 20+10+10 =40 marks:
20 marks for documentation, evaluated by (guiding teacher and External examiner)
10 marks for presentation : evaluated by Guiding teacher
10 marks for viva: evaluated by External examiner
